What Is Visual Merchandising?
Visual merchandising is the practice of designing and organizing a retail space to create an engaging shopping experience that encourages customers to make purchases. This includes everything from the layout of the store to the lighting, displays, signage, and even the music. The goal is to communicate a brand’s identity and showcase its products in a way that resonates with the target audience.
Store Layout
A well-designed store layout is the backbone of visual merchandising. The layout determines how customers move through the space and interact with products. For example, a grid layout, often used in grocery stores, promotes efficiency and ensures that customers can easily locate what they need. On the other hand, free-flow layouts, commonly found in boutiques, encourage customers to explore and discover new items, fostering a sense of curiosity and engagement.

Lighting
Lighting is a powerful tool that can set the mood and emphasize specific areas of a store. Bright, focused lighting on key displays or new arrivals can draw attention and highlight products that retailers want to promote. Ambient lighting, on the other hand, creates a welcoming and comfortable atmosphere that encourages customers to linger. Effective lighting enhances the overall shopping experience while subtly guiding customers through the space.
Color Psychology
Colors play a significant role in shaping customers’ emotions and purchasing decisions. Warm colors like red and orange can create a sense of urgency and energy, making them ideal for clearance or promotional sections. Cool tones like blue and green evoke calmness, sophistication, and trust, making them perfect for luxury or wellness-focused brands. By understanding and leveraging color psychology, retailers can craft displays that subtly influence customers’ perceptions and behaviors.

Trends in Visual Merchandising for 2025
The future of visual merchandising is blending creativity with technology and sustainability. Digital integration is becoming increasingly prominent, with interactive screens, augmented reality (AR), and QR codes creating a seamless connection between physical and digital shopping. Sustainability is also taking center stage, with eco-friendly displays made from recycled or reusable materials appealing to environmentally conscious consumers. Minimalist aesthetics are gaining popularity, focusing on clean, clutter-free designs that highlight hero products and emphasize quality. Additionally, data-driven merchandising is revolutionizing the industry by using analytics to design displays tailored to specific customer preferences and behaviors.
